11 Best Artificial Intelligence Course Online, Tutorial & Certification 2025
Artificial Intelligence is ruling the world with its power. People of all ages can benefit from the best artificial intelligence courses. Because it’s easy to understand. It helps businesses, work, and even students.
Now we can’t imagine our day without AI. It is spreading like fire. People use it in every possible field, like medicine, business, finance, and even agriculture.
However, AI has unlocked new and exciting jobs that never existed a few years back.
According to a recent report, global spending on AI tools, software, and services is expected to double by 2028, reaching $632 billion. That means AI is growing fast, with an annual growth of 29% from 2024 to 2028. Source : IDC research
It makes perfect sense to explore AI now, as it helps you save time and work smarter, simplifying your work. It allows businesses, workers, and even students to solve problems. People use AI in various useful ways.
But you’re missing a big opportunity if you don’t know how to use it correctly.
There are plenty of the best Artificial Intelligence Courses available online.
Top universities, experts, and tech companies offer courses with certifications that cover everything from basic to advanced AI topics like deep learning and natural language processing.
How to Choose Best Artificial Intelligence Courses
With so many AI courses out there, picking the right one can also be tough and tricky.
But if you take the time to compare things like the content, how long it takes to finish, who created it, and how much it costs, you can find a course that fits your goal, needs, and budget.
Here are some key things to look at for finding the best Artificial Intelligence training:
1. What You Need to Know Before You Start
Check if the course matches your current skills. If you’re new to AI, look for beginner courses that explain the basics, like how to use Python or understand simple math and code.
If you already have experience, you might want something more advanced that covers deeper topics like calculus, probability, or tools like PyTorch and TensorFlow.
2. What the Course Teaches
Make sure the course matches your goals and your current skills.
If you’re interested in things like AI for images (computer vision), voice assistants (NLP), or smart decision making, find a course that covers those topics.
A good course should teach you both the theory and the practical part.
3. How the Course Is Taught
Think about how you like to learn. Do you
prefer working at your place, or do you like having scheduled classes and group projects? Some AI tutorials offer live support, mentors, or group discussions, which can be helpful for a new student.
Others are self-paced and let you study anytime, but should still have good videos, notes, and support if you get stuck.
4. Building Real Projects
Look for courses that let you build real practice. This proves that you’ve used what you’ve learned.
Good examples might be creating a chat-bot, building an app that can recognize photos, or making a recommendation system like Netflix.
Try to pick a course where you can work with real data, practice officially, and even learn how to show your work to others, just like in a real job.
11 Best Artificial Intelligence Courses Online, and Certification 2025
The best AI course certification for you depends on your goals and ambitions, which part of AI you’re interested in, and how much you already know.
Some courses are made for beginners, while others expect you to know a bit about how AI technology works. Whether you’re a beginner or looking to advance your skills, AI courses can help you gain expertise and get certified.
To help you make a better choice, we researched in depth. These programs range from beginner to advanced certifications offered by top universities like The Harvard University.
With a lot of options that include artificial intelligence tutorials, official projects, and industry-recognized certificates.
Take a look at the Top Artificial Intelligence Training options available in 2025. Explore the future of AI technology.
1. AI for Everyone by Andrew Ng (Coursera)
AI is for everyone, not just engineers. This course is great for helping your team, especially non-technical people, learn how to use AI.
This Course is for
AI is for everyone, not just engineers. This course is great for helping your team, especially non-technical people, learn how to use AI.
Student Enrolled: 1,800,000+
Rating: 4.8/5
Duration: Approx 6 hours
Level: Beginner.
Key Features the Course
- Focuses on Machine Learning
- AI technology and practical projects
Taught by: AI Expert Andrew Ng.
Why Should You Take This Course?
This course does not require programming, and it has some understandable AI concepts, but no coding.
This is an ideal course for business professionals and non-tech learners.
Coursera: https://www.coursera.org/learn/ai-for-everyone
2. Artificial Intelligence A-Z 2025 by Hadelin(Udemy)
Learn how to use Agentic AI, Generative AI, and reward-based learning to build smart tools for real-world problems.
Student Enrolled: 322,254+
Level: Beginner to advanced
Rating:4.4/5
You will Learn:
- Build 7 different AI models for various real-world applications.
- Learn core AI concepts and theory, including state-of-the-art models.
- Master reinforcement learning techniques like Q-Learning and Deep Q-Learning.
- Explore advanced algorithms such as A3C, PPO, and SAC.
- Understand LLMs and Transformers, including LoRA and QLoRA.
- Apply NLP techniques like tokenization, padding, and fine-tuning for chatbots.
- Gain extra insights into DDPG, World Models, Evolution Strategies, and Genetic Algorithms.
Why Should You Take This Course?
This course offers a valuable certificate and teaches AI through 7 different real-world applications.
It’s perfect if you are curious about how AI affects business and society, but it’s not diving you into code.
Udemy: https://www.udemy.com/course/artificial-intelligence-az/
3. Generative AI for Everyone by Rav Ahuja (edX)
This course makes Generative AI easy to understand, even if you’re just starting out. You’ll learn how it works and how it’s being used to create things like text, images, and more in everyday life.
Student Enrolled: 52,000+
Level: Beginner to advanced
Rating: 4.4/5
Duration: 4 months
Why Should You Take This Course?
This specialization is the gold standard for deep learning. It is designed for people who are serious about entering AI and machine learning roles.
This course provides real-world projects. No prior experience required.
edX; https://www.edx.org/certificates/professional-certificate/ibm-generative-ai-for-everyone
4. AI Essentials for Business by Karim Lakhani (Harvard University)
In this Harvard Business School (HBS) Online course, you’ll learn how to succeed in a world ruled by AI.This course shows you how to use AI to grow your business smarter and faster.
Course type: Paid
Pace: Self-paced
Duration: 4 weeks long
Why Should You Take This Course?
AI Essentials for Business will teach you how to use AI to grow your business smartly and responsibly. You’ll learn how to use AI in your work to find new opportunities and stay ahead of the competition.
Harvard University: https://pll.harvard.edu/course/ai-essentials-business
5. Introduction to Artificial Intelligence by Rav Ahuja(Coursera)
This course helps you understand the basics of AI, including key terms, tools, and real-world uses. You’ll learn about machine learning, deep learning, and generative AI, as large language models (LLMs)
Student Enrolled: 570,000+
Level: Beginner
Rating:4.7/5
Why Should You Take This Course?
This is one of the most influential AI courses ever. It’s foundational for understanding machine learning from a very beginner standpoint.
Coursera: https://www.coursera.org/learn/introduction-to-ai
6. IBM AI Product Manager Professional Certificate by Rav Ahuja (Coursera)
Start your career as an AI Product Manager. Learn the skills you need to get a job in product management and generative AI in 3 months or less.
Student Enrolled: 29,000+
Level: Beginner (Business)
Rating: 4.6/5
Duration: 3 months
What you’ll learn:
- Apply key product management skills, tools, and techniques to manage clients.
- Understand the role of an AI Product Manager and how to manage AI-focused projects.
Why Should You Take This Course?
This professional certificate, supported by IBM, prepares you for AI jobs and includes real-world projects using popular tools.
Coursera: https://www.coursera.org/professional-certificates/ibm-ai-product-manage
7. AI for Beginners by Microsoft (Microsoft)
The curriculum of this course is beginner-friendly and covers tools like TensorFlow and PyTorch, as well as ethics in AI.
Student Enrolled: 24,000+
Level: Beginner
Rating:4.6/5
Why Should You Take This Course?
It’s free, personalized, and up-to-date content.
What you will learn: In this curriculum, you will learn
- Classical AI methods :often referred to as GOFAI (“Good Old-Fashioned AI”), focus on teaching computers to think using facts, rules, and logic.
- Neural Networks and Deep Learning: The Foundation of Modern AI. They will show you the main ideas with practical examples using two popular tools: TensorFlow and PyTorch.
- AI models that work with images and text. They will look at some of the newer models, though they might not cover the very latest ones in depth.
- You’ll also learn about some less common AI methods, like Genetic Algorithms and Multi-Agent Systems, which provide you with different ways for solving problems.
Microsoft: https://microsoft.github.io/AI-For-Beginners/
8. AI Programming with Python by Mat Leonard (Udacity)
Learn how to get started with Python for AI using tools like NumPy, pandas, and Matplotlib. Build and train machine learning models with popular Python libraries and create neural networks using PyTorch.
Level: Beginner
Rating:4.8/5
Key Features of This Course
- Get hands-on experience with deep learning.
- Explore generative AI for language tasks with this course.
Why Should You Take This Course?
This course is great for those with some programming experience and prepares you for more advanced AI and machine learning studies or a career in AI.
Udacity: https://www.udacity.com/course/ai-programming-python-nanodegree–nd089
9. Using ChatGPT for Work by Víctor Mollá (Domestika)
The main highlight of this course is a project that helps you use AI to handle low-value tasks, so you can focus on what matters
Student Enrolled: 49,000+
Rating: 4.8/5.
Why Should You Take This Course?
Because it shows you how to use AI—like ChatGPT to save time, boost creativity, and solve real-world problems in tech, SEO, and product development.
Domestika: https://www.domestika.org/en/courses/5455-using-chatgpt-for-work
10. Introduction to Generative AI Learning Path (Google)
This short beginner course explains what Generative AI is, how it works, and how it’s different from regular machine learning.
Student Enrolled: 20,000+
Level: Beginner
Rating: 4.7/5
Why Should You Take This Course?
Complete this course to earn a badge you can add to your profile. It’s a great way to show what you’ve learned, build your skills, and get a head start on your future career in tech
Cloudskill: https://www.cloudskillsboost.google/paths/118/course_templates/536
11. Creating Presentations with AI (Domestika)
Learn how to make great presentations using AI tools. Find out simple ways to keep your audience interester
Student Enrolled: 30,000+
Rating: 4.9/5
Why Should You Take This Course?
This course teaches you how to create better, more engaging presentations using AI. With guidance from expert designer Katya Kovalenko, you’ll learn simple and effective ways to save time, tell your story visually, and make your message clear.
Domestika: https://www.domestika.org/en/courses/5458-creating-presentations-with-ai
Final Thoughts – Best Artificial Intelligence Certification
AI isn’t just a hot topic anymore, it’s a powerful tool that’s here to help us regularly. It is changing how we live and making our work simpler and easier.
The more AI becomes part of our day-to-day lives, the more valuable it is to know how to use it effectively and wisely. By choosing the best artificial intelligence course, you can be a game-changer for yourself.
Especially your career as AI technology continues to change the world faster. These best artificial intelligence courses ain’t just teach the theory but also give you real practice with tools that are used in machine learning and AI technology.
Whether you’re a complete beginner or an experienced developer who wants to add AI to their skills, these AI training courses give you practical experience with real-world projects.
These best AI courses designed to help you build real skills and confidence in Artificial Intelligence step by step. Start your new journey today with the right artificial intelligence training, and be a part of the exciting changes that AI technology is bringing to every sector of work and life.
Some Common FAQ’s on the Best Artificial Intelligence Courses
01. Can I learn AI as a beginner?
The great thing is, you don’t need to be super technical to use AI. It’s popular because it’s powerful, but also because it’s easy to access. If you’re online, you can start using it right now.
02. How long does it take to complete an AI course online?
It depends. Most best AI courses range from a few weeks to a few months. Self-paced courses are always flexible, but professional certification artificial intelligence tutorial programs may take longer.
03. Are AI certifications valuable for jobs?
Yes, these artificial intelligence training programs can increase the value of your resume, especially if it includes a project portfolio.
04. What topics are typically covered in an artificial intelligence course?
You can work as an AI developer, machine learning engineer, AI product manager, data scientist, or even a prompt engineer.
05. Can I study AI part-time?
Yes, most courses are flexible and designed to fit your schedule.
Ready to transform your future with AI skills? Choose a course and start learning today!